About This Book

James Alexander Thom, bestselling author of two magnificent historical novels, says about his modern novel, Staying Out of Hell:

"Like my character, Scotty Montgomery, I grew up in the idyllic prewar Midwest, was a Marine, and later a journalist appalled by the apparent cheapness of life and the world's casual disregard for human suffering. Like my protagonist, I am unable to reconcile my country's two roles: the citadel of humane idealism, and the leading world merchant of death-dealing weapons.  I hope by this novel to awaken our benumbed souls to the awful absurdities with which we live."
